Chlorella Powder

Chlorella powder is a nutrient-dense green superfood derived from freshwater algae, known for its high protein content and rich array of vitamins and minerals. It is often used as a dietary supplement to enhance overall health and wellness.

Rich in chlorophyll, chlorella powder supports detoxification by binding to heavy metals and toxins in the body.
High in protein and essential amino acids, making it an excellent supplement for vegetarians and vegans.

Aged Whey Powder

Aged whey powder is a concentrated source of protein derived from the liquid byproduct of cheese production, known for its rich amino acid profile and potential health benefits.

Supports muscle growth and recovery due to its high protein content and essential amino acids.
May enhance immune function and promote gut health through the presence of bioactive compounds.
